Top paying industries
The top 3 paying industries for Principal Devops Engineer in United States are Information Technology with a median total pay of $295,057, Telecommunications with a median total pay of $215,623 and Financial Services with a median total pay of $214,805.
Frequently asked questions about Principal DevOps Engineer salaries
The average salary for Principal DevOps Engineer is $206,774 per year or $99 per hour, with top earners making up to $310,868 (90th percentile). Typically, pay ranges from $168,730 (25th percentile) to $257,072 (75th percentile) annually. Salary estimates are based on 312 salaries submitted anonymously to Glassdoor by Principal DevOps Engineer employees.
